          Originally posted by xviper2
          Just saw this. Thanks. I was going to put the ones from the S. Scorpion. I have them in my Venom and they work great.
          I have them on my Venom as well but found them a bit too soft so I clipped 3 coils off them to make them firmer...I also found them too soft on the Stinger90 but the F-15's are perfect especially if you have indiscretions on your grass field as I believe you have..
